Barack Obama returning from summer vacation ready for busy fall

in Statewide/Top Headlines by

President Barack Obama is returning from vacation rested and ready for a busy fall, including pressing Congress for money to protect against the Zika virus and fending off lawmakers’ attacks over the administration’s $400 million “leverage” payment to Iran. Obama also is expected to campaign doggedly to help elect Democrat Hillary Clinton as president. Obama was due at the White House late Sunday after a 16-day getaway to Martha’s Vineyard, Massachusetts, with his wife, Michelle, and daughters Malia and Sasha.…

Marco Rubio to campaign with Mike Pence, while keeping distance from Donald Trump

in 2017/Top Headlines by

Marco Rubio is agreeing to appear with Republican vice-presidential nominee Mike Pence, even as the Florida Senator and former presidential candidate keeps his distance from Donald Trump. ABC News reports that after several phone conversations, Pence and Rubio could begin campaigning in Florida within the next few weeks. After ending his presidential bid, Rubio is currently seeking re-election to the U.S. Senate. Donald Trump speech will focus on ‘foreign policy realism’

in 2017/Top Headlines by

Donald Trump will declare an end to nation-building if elected president, replacing it with what aides described as ‘‘foreign policy realism’’ focused on destroying the Islamic State and other terrorist organizations. In a speech the Republican presidential nominee was scheduled to deliver Monday in Ohio, Trump will argue that the country needs to work with anyone who shares that mission, regardless of other ideological and strategic disagreements. Stephen Colbert to air live after Donald Trump – Hillary Clinton presidential debates

in 2017/Top Headlines by

Stephen Colbert, who capitalized on the political conventions with live airings of his late-night show, will do the same for the presidential and vice presidential debates. “The Late Show with Stephen Colbert” will air live on CBS after the scheduled Sept. 26 and Oct. 19 debates between Hillary Clinton and Donald Trump and following the Tim Kaine–Mike Pence debate Oct. 4, the network said Wednesday.
